Art
Growing up moving to different cities, houses and different countries, art was the only thing constant in my life.Â
As a child, I was very good in science and art. My favorite class was art. I used to get Aâs and I used to draw every day. It was my escape. One day my grandmother told me that drawing and art were for crazy people. â People who draw every day end up crazy.â As a good innocent kid, I stop drawing completely. She was coming from a good place. She didnât want art to be my career and my life due to the underlying uncertainties of being an artist. But I didnât want to make art my career I just wanted to draw. It was my refuge. Â
